C-SPAN Reports Shooting Threat Against CNN’s Don Lemon, Brian Stelter to FBI

“Washington Journal” host did not hear caller’s threat, C-SPAN says

After a caller threatened to shoot CNN anchors Don Lemon and Brian Stelter on C-SPAN air late last week, the public service network said Monday that the show’s host “did not hear the comment.”

C-SPAN also said it reported the threat to the FBI.

The on-air threat occurred during Friday morning’s “open phones” segment of “Washington Journal.” A man who said he was from Pennsylvania accused Stelter and Lemon of calling Trump supporters “racist,” adding, “They started the war, I see them I’m going to shoot them. Bye.”

Stelter replayed the call on CNN air Sunday during “Reliable Sources,” as seen in the video above.

C-SPAN pointed to its network guidance on handling “offensive, inaccurate or threatening statements” in its Monday statement. It includes that “hosts are expected to step in to cut off the call” during such instances.
